Abstract:
Disparities in disease outcomes between black and white patients with endometrial cancer may be due in part to inherent differences in the disease biology. This study has identified conserved molecular alterations between black and white patients with endometrioid endometrial cancer correlating with differential disease outcomes, and it provides further insights into the association of race‐specific biology with disease prognosis in patients with endometrial cancer.
